When I picked up a camera for the first time almost 25 years ago, I honestly never intended for it to become a “business.” Photography has been a labor of love, a passion, really a lifestyle for me, and when I’m out in the field with my camera, I rarely feel like what I’m doing could be classified as “work.”
But over the years, I’ve been fortunate enough to work with so many great clients, many of whom have become fantastic friends, and Corey Rich Productions has organically expanded to include a team of like-minded individuals to keep our office in South Lake Tahoe running smoothly.

I was excited to bring aboard Josh Marianelli last June as Studio Director / Producer for CRP. Josh and I first met about four years ago at the Rich Clarkson Adventure Photography Workshop in Jackson, Wyoming, where we were both instructors. Josh was then working in New York City as a freelance photographer, producer, studio manager, digital capture and lighting tech; a jack of all trades. He has a contagious passion for photography and a wealth of knowledge in all aspects of making creative digital media. Convincing him to leave Brooklyn and come work with me in the Sierra Nevada Mountains did not require much arm twisting and was a real blessing.

Josh and his wife, Julia Schwadron Marianelli, moved here last Fall and they immediately settled into the Tahoe lifestyle.
